Gone ape **** after purchasing your first handgun and bought about a dozen holsters and all kinds of different grips thinking you'd need 'em, and when you finally came to your senses you thought to yourself "What in the world was I thinking? That holster is garbage! And so is that one, and that one, and those grips really suck, and... oh heck, I'll just store 'em for....." And there they sit collecting dust.
I bought a Bianchi shoulder rig, a DeSantis pancake, a Fobus paddle, and not a one of them is worth a plugged nickle. Well, actually the DeSantis is a pretty good OWB for concealment. But what in God's name was I thinking when I purchased that Fobus off of Ebay for $30, and thought I was going to have a good CCW rig! And then I bought Hogue wrap arounds with the finger notches, and some smooth Cocobolos.
Footnote - I have a Brommelandgunleather holster Max Con V, on its way for my 1911. Let's hope this ends my saga of holster purchases!
Just thought I'd share my newbie experiences with you guys.
